Hi, Recently my raspberry pi destroyed a 32GB SD card after only 4 days, because that cheap SD card seemed to have issues with wear-leveling. The areas where the ext4 journal was stored were no longer read- or writeable. I wonder which write-access patterns nilfs2 does exhibit. Are there any frequent in-place updates to statically positioned data structures (superblock, translation tables, ...) or is the data mostly written sequentially?
